Automated Telematics & Fleet IoT

Future-ready fleets are equipped with 4G LTE/GPS cloud transceivers natively wired into the main CAN-bus system. Enterprise purchasers can track vehicle location, battery State of Health (SOH), driver behavior, and geofencing violations across multi-site industrial complexes in real time.

Modular Chassis Platforms

Sourcing strategies now emphasize modular chassis systems. A standardized base frame can be rapidly converted from a 4-passenger utility buggy into a flatbed cargo trolley or hydraulic lift rig, drastically reducing inventory carrying costs for replacement parts.

Ultra-Fast Charging Protocols

The standard shift toward onboard automotive-grade chargers allows full recharge cycles in under 2.5 hours using standard 110V-240V outlets. Integration with solar-assisted canopy roofs is extending operational duty cycles by up to 20% in sun-rich environments.

What compliance documentation is required when importing electric fleet carts from China?

For smooth customs clearance and legal operation, commercial importers must ensure suppliers provide a comprehensive documentation package. This includes UN38.3 certification, MSDS, and non-dangerous goods transport certificates for Lithium-ion battery packs. Vehicle-level documentation requires CE marking under the Machinery Directive, DOT certification (with conforming 17-digit VIN numbers and DOT-approved windscreens/seatbelts) for US street-legal low-speed vehicles (LSVs), or EEC type-approval certificates for European Union markets.

How does a 72V lithium platform outperform traditional 48V lead-acid systems in commercial applications?

A 72V lithium system delivers significant operational advantages. By operating at a higher voltage, the vehicle draws lower current (amperage) for the same power output, resulting in significantly less thermal build-up in wiring and controllers. This grants up to 40% greater range per charge cycle, superior hill-climbing torque, and faster acceleration. Furthermore, LiFePO4 batteries offer a 3,500+ deep-discharge cycle life (compared to 500-800 cycles for lead-acid), zero routine maintenance (no acid topping), and eliminate over 200 kg of dead weight, improving payload capacity.

What custom OEM/ODM modifications can be requested for large-scale fleet orders?

Industrial exporters accommodate extensive customization options. Frame modifications include wheelbase extension for custom cargo beds, integration of electro-hydraulic scissor lift decks, or specialized heavy-duty towing hitches. Electrical modifications include custom drive profiles, installation of 24V/12V step-down converters for auxiliary beacons and radio systems, integrated telemetry modules, and custom wiring channels. Aesthetic customization includes custom RAL paint matching, screen-printed corporate branding, and specialized weather-enclosure curtains.

What logistics protocols are recommended for sea freight container shipping of electric vehicles?

When shipping electric fleet carts internationally, vehicles are typically shipped via High-Cube (40HQ) ocean containers using SKD (Semi-Knocked Down) or CBU (Completely Built Up) packing methods. CBU packing utilizes custom steel-frame crates stacked two levels high inside the container, protecting body panels from vibration and impact damage. Batteries must be isolated at a 30% State of Charge (SOC) in accordance with international maritime dangerous goods (IMDG) standards, with emergency disconnect switches activated during transit.

How are spare parts logistics and warranty claims handled for international fleet deployments?

Established Chinese suppliers implement a strategic spare parts program. Contracts usually include a 2% to 5% fast-moving consumable spare parts package (such as replacement relays, brake pads, lights, and switches) packed directly inside the initial container shipment. For major warranty components (motor, controller, battery pack, chassis), tier-1 manufacturers maintain regional warehouse stocks or provide rapid air-freight replacement service backed by a transparent 3 to 10-year factory warranty protocol.
